## Summary

TSCO has been cut nearly in half from its 52W high ($63.99 → $29.36, -54%, -41% YTD) and just delivered a double miss with lowered guidance on the Q2 CY2026 print (GAAP EPS $0.69 vs $0.82 est, -15.9%; revenue $4.54B miss). Valuation has compressed to ~13x forward EPS with a 3.3% dividend and best-in-class 45.5% ROE, but with operating margins visibly compressing (Q1'26 op margin 6.5% vs Q2'25 13.0%), the story is a value-vs-value-trap coin toss until comps stabilize. The Kronos multi-timeframe forecast is uniformly bullish, but realized directional accuracy (42% 1d, 33% 1wk) is BELOW the naive baseline, so its optimism should be discounted, not leaned on.

## News context

The dominant, primary-source catalyst is today's 8-K (2026-07-23, Items 2.02/9.01): Q2 earnings plus a full-year guidance revision. Independent recap coverage confirms GAAP EPS $0.69 (-14.8% YoY, -16% vs consensus) on revenue $4.54B (+2.3% YoY but a miss). The Instacart same-day-delivery rollout across 2,400 stores (Jul 22) is a modest positive — expands digital reach but is a margin-neutral partnership, not a needle-mover. The Farmer Veteran Coalition donation is PR. Congressional trade (Tuberville joint account sold $1-15K on Jun 8) is a small negative sentiment tick but immaterial in size. Social sentiment skews 75% bullish among a small sample, which is a mild contrarian caution flag given the price action. Net: the news backdrop is dominated by a fundamental miss with lowered guidance — that trumps everything else.
